Monday, California Gov. Gavin Newsom announced a plan to send billions in state surplus dollars back to residents. Republicans who support recalling Newsom from office are questioning his timing.

States nationwide are facing $200 billion in lost revenue due to stalled economies during the coronavirus pandemic. Many are asking the federal government to step in, or they say big cuts are ahead.
